Output de5233e05d0e595aeb0700a60fc4e7f478f0d462359d899b8a8f0ff6c38340b3:1

value
17778353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4912eeaf8c4468d81c29d0ea521fda922308cfdb OP_EQUALVERIFY OP_CHECKSIG
address
17fP1SxL6PT2ZQoGaLADCrjYRiFrXmrx2S
transaction
de5233e05d0e595aeb0700a60fc4e7f478f0d462359d899b8a8f0ff6c38340b3
confirmations
273047
spent
true